Paris Olympics 2024: 68 coaches, 50 officials to accompany Indian athletes at summer games

(Courtesy : SAI Media)
PT Usha hails team colloboration for their efforts in sending Indian contigent to Paris Olympics 2024.
PT Usha showed her appreciation towards the Ministry of Youth affairs and sports, National sports federations for successfully working with each other. She felt that the teamwork involved has helped the Indian Olympic Committee ahead of the Paris Olympics 2024.
The President of the IOA also dismissed allegations of misleading reports of their organisation. She said, “Together with the Ministry of Youth Affairs and Sports and its units, the National Sports Federations and a good bunch of corporate partners, IOA had forged unprecedented teamwork. It is shocking that some have turned a blind eye to such synergy.”
PT Usha also addressed the issue of wrestler Amit Panghal and her support staff not getting visas for Paris Olympics 2024. Panghal’s coach, Bhagat Singh, physiotherapist Heera, sparring partner Vikas and masseur Nisha have not received their visas yet for the summer games.
Panghals worries will come to an end as PT Usha has said that she has looked into the case. The three-time Olympian mentioned about Panghal’s father getting in touch with the IOA regarding the case. She will now take up Panghal’s case to the embassy of France.

PT Usha has informed the media to not publish reports without the necessary information. She proclaimed that the IOA has been assisting athletes and their staff in every possible way.
PT Usha said, “I will continue to strive to put my best foot forward when it comes to ensuring the best possible support for each and every athlete in our contingent.”
The IOA has released the list of total number of athletes, support staff and officials who will be part of the Indian contingent at Paris Olympics 2024. There will be a total of 117 athletes, 68 coaches and 50 support staff.
